About the role

  • Acquires new customers by meeting or exceeding goals for growth objectives via telephone/video and periodic sales calls and presentations.
  • Build relationships with new customers while growing the revenue and profits through service changes, cross-selling and price increases.
  • Implement sales strategies to maximize revenue and profits through maintenance and penetration of all assigned customers.
  • Resolve problems and coordinate customer needs with Operations and/or Customer Experience group.
  • Works as liaison between customers and accounts payable department for collection of receivables when requested.
  • Actively participate in Regional Sales Meetings and overall regional strategies.
  • Sell in a highly consultative manner, with ability to articulate the company value-proposition and the benefits of working with Clean Earth brand over other traditional waste services companies and direct competition.
  • Create presentations for key sales prospects.
  • Coordinate the development of sales objectives, territory and account selling strategies and ensures their execution.
  • Completes territory forecasts.
  • Respond and implement all steps to win incoming leads matching the revenue value outlined for this role.
  • Make daily calls on new prospects within territory geography, along with identifying leads via a variety of internet websites, networking, key vendors and peers within local and national organizations.
  • Monitor and communicate sales performance against goals through approved performance metrics.
  • Perform other reasonably related tasks assigned by management.

Requirements

  • Bachelor’s Degree in Business, Sciences, Marketing or Management or Associates degree with 1+ years of experience in environmental
  • Minimum of 1 year experience in sales or customer service, or other related field.
  • Knowledge of RCRA, DOT, DEA regulatory environment preferred
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Word, Excel and PowerPoint, Salesforce.com
  • Experience in managing a territory while demonstrating a proven track record of sales success achieving or exceeding aggressive growth targets and sales quotas, preferred
  • Self-directed with the ability to work on multiple projects with competing priorities and deadlines
  • Demonstrates established relationships or the ability to rapidly establish relationships within the C-level, Regulatory Affairs, Quality, Procurement, Supply Chain, Operations and Marketing functions within the retail industry
  • Demonstrates established relationships or the ability to rapidly establish relationships within the Environmental Health and Safety, Regulatory Affairs, Quality, Procurement, Supply Chain, Operations and Marketing functions within the manufacturing industry.
